Understanding Tilt and its Impact
Tilt is a state of emotional frustration that can significantly impact your performance in Overwatch or any computer game. This frustration often arises from a series of losses, bad plays, or unfavorable circumstances during gameplay. Tilt can manifest as anger, impatience, or irrational decision-making, leading to a negative impact on your overall performance and enjoyment of the game. Recognizing the signs of tilt is important to effectively deal with it and prevent it from affecting your gameplay.
Strategies to Prevent Tilt
One effective strategy to prevent tilt in Overwatch is to take breaks between games. Stepping away from the game, even if just for a few minutes, can help you reset your mindset and emotions, allowing you to approach the next game with a fresh perspective. Additionally, practicing mindfulness techniques, such as deep breathing exercises or meditation, can help you stay grounded and focused, reducing the likelihood of tilt.
Setting realistic goals for each gaming session can also help prevent tilt. Instead of focusing solely on winning every game, try to set goals related to improving specific aspects of your gameplay, such as communication with your team, positioning, or target prioritization. By shifting your focus to personal improvement rather than just winning, you can reduce the negative impact of losses and setbacks on your emotional state.
Dealing with Tilt during Gameplay
During gameplay, it is essential to monitor your emotional state and recognize the early signs of tilt. If you find yourself becoming increasingly frustrated or angry, it may be time to take a short break to refocus. In situations where tilt is already affecting your performance, try to focus on re-establishing your composure and mindset. Remind yourself that tilt is a natural reaction to frustration and that you have the power to control your emotions.
When dealing with tilt during gameplay, communication with your team can play a crucial role. Informing your teammates that you are feeling frustrated or tilted can help them provide support and adjust their playstyle accordingly. Additionally, seeking feedback and advice from more experienced players or coaches can help you gain a new perspective on the situation, allowing you to approach the game with a clearer mindset.
Post-Game Reflection and Improvement
After a gaming session, take the time to reflect on your performance and identify potential triggers for tilt. Analyze your gameplay, decision-making process, and emotional reactions to losses or setbacks. By identifying patterns or behaviors that contribute to tilt, you can develop strategies to address these issues and prevent them from recurring in future games.
Engaging in self-care activities outside of gaming can also help you manage tilt more effectively. Physical exercise, healthy eating habits, and sufficient rest are essential for maintaining your overall well-being and emotional resilience. By taking care of your physical and mental health, you can enhance your ability to cope with frustration and setbacks during gameplay.
